Szczuku Posted December 10, 2018 Share Posted December 10, 2018 The jungle is supposed to fight with itself. Devs are still trying to find balance between creatures. Btw the way to do with ladybugs is to trigger only 1-3 packs of them. Cuz if you around the jungle you'll trigger like 12 packs and then you'll have 50 ladybugs going after you and kiling everything in their path Link to comment https://forums.kleientertainment.com/forums/topic/100403-make-the-jungle-stop-fighting-itself/#findComment-1130021 Share on other sites More sharing options...
